Hydrogeneration allows the flow of water to charge the batttery while under sail. Hydrogeneration operates effectively between 3 knots and 16 knots, generating approximately 380 W of power at 10 knots, up to 1.5kW at 16 knots.

| Power (W) | Speed (knots/mph/kph) | Runtime** (hh:mm) | Range (nm/mi/km)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 500 | 4.0 / 4.6 / 7.4 | 3:00 | 11.3 / 13 / 21 |
| 1000 | 5.2 / 6.0 / 9.6 | 1:48 | 8.3 / 9.6 / 15.4 |
| 2000 | 9.5 / 10.9 / 17.5 | 0:54 | 7 / 8.1 / 13 |
| 3000 Sport Mode *** | 11.3 / 13.0 / 21.0 |
** This performance data is based on an 11.5-foot aluminum boat weighing 65 kg, with one person and one Spirit battery in calm lake water. Actual speed, range, and running time may vary due to different boat types, loads, weather conditions, and other factors. Sport Mode can last up to 1 minute with a minimum battery state of charge (SOC) of 20%, and the temperature must be within safe limits.
*** The runtime is measured from 100% to 5% SoC. Below 5% SoC, the power will be limited to a maximum of 50 W, enabling the Spirit 2 to continue operating at 50 W for for an extended period.
| Nominal Power | 2 kW |
| Maximum Power (in Sport Mode) | 3 kW |
| Battery Capacity | 1539 Wh |
| Motor Weight* (excluding bracket) | Extra Short: 10.2 kg Short: 10.4 kg Long: 10.7 kg |
| Motor Weight* (including bracket) | Extra Short: 12.6 kg Short: 12.8 kg Long: 13.1 kg |
| Battery Weight | 10.4 kg |
| Battery Life | 1000 cycles at 80% DOD |
| Charging Time | Standard charger: 8 Hrs / Fast charger: 2 Hrs |
| External Battery | ePropulsion E Series Battery |
| Charging Temperature | -15°C – 60°C Charging below 0°C requires the use of fast charger (with battery communication function) |
| Operating Temperature | -10°C – 65°C |
| Storage Temperature | 5°C – 40°C |
| Rated RPM | 1700 to 2100 |
| Trim Angle Adjustment | 0°, 7°, 14°, 21° |
| Tilt Angle | 70°, 90° |
| Shallow Water Mode Tilt Angle | 35° |
| Steering Range | ±90° |
| Dimensions | Extra Short: 410 x 190 x 915 mm Short: 410 x 190 x 1015 mm Long: 410 x 190 x 1140 mm |
| Propeller | 2-blade composite propeller, diameter 240mm, pitch 167mm |
* Weight shown based on short shaft model
